About Brass Metal Push Button
A Brass metal push button is a type of momentary switch used to control electrical circuits. It consists of a brass or other metal body with a spring-loaded button that, when pushed, completes a circuit and sends a signal to the connected device.The Brass metal push button is designed to be reliable and durable, with a simple and easy-to-use mechanism. It is typically used in low-voltage or low-current applications, such as in control panels, alarm systems, or industrial equipment.

Q: When should a normally open (NO) momentary switch be used?
A: A normally open momentary switch is ideal when you want the circuit to be completed only while the button is actively pressed-common in start, reset, or signal operations within control panels and electrical switchboards.

Q: How does the IP40 rating influence the environmental usage of this push button?
A: With an IP40 rating, the switch is protected against solid objects over 1 mm but is not sealed against water. As such, it is best suited for indoor environments where exposure to moisture is not a concern.
